- Home
- Companies
- united kingdom
- solar product
Refine by
Solar Product Suppliers In United Kingdom For Served Monitoring And Testing
1 companies found
based inLeichhardt, AUSTRALIA
Solcast deploys data and tools to build the solar powered future. Our mission is to enable yours, by making it fast, easy and affordable to access solar data services all around the world. We provide solar resource assessment and forecasting data ...